Communism (from *communis* -- common, shared) is a very wide term which most generally stands for the idea that sharing and equality should be the basic values and principles of a society; as such it is a [leftist](left_right.md) idea which falls under [socialism](socialism.md) (i.e. basically focusing on people at large). There are very many branches, theories, political ideologies and schools of thought somewhat based on communism, for example [Marxism](marxism.md), [Leninism](leninism.md), [anarcho communism](ancom.md), primitive communism, Christian communism, Buddhist communism etc. -- of course, some of these are good while others are evil and only abuse the word communism as a kind of *brand* (as also happens e.g. with [anarchism](anarchism.md)). Common ideas usually associated with communism are (please keep in mind that this may differ depending on the specific flavor of communism):
- Ending [capitalism](capitalism.md) and similar rightist oppressive hierarchical systems which are the polar opposite of communism and are incompatible with it. Along with these also things like [consumerism](consumerism.md), worker exploitation, crime and poverty will disappear.
- Abolishment of private property, establishing common ownership, for example a factory shouldn't have a single owner who makes profit off of it, it should rather be collectively managed by those who work in the factory and they should collectively share what they make there.
- Sharing and collaboration as opposed to [competition](competition.md).
- Equality, seizing of division of people into social classes (such as workers, [bourgeoisie](bourgeoisie.md), rich, poor, aristocracy, ...).
- Eventual abolishment of [state](state.md), as again in a good society that benefits people there shouldn't be any crime, theft, abuse of workers etc. However some "communists" see state and its control of economy as a necessary intermediate step towards this goal.
- Abolishment of [money](money.md) as that is a means of dividing people into classes (rich and poor), means of abuse (wage slavery) and a tool of systems such as capitalism. In a good society money is unnecessary, everyone gets what he needs.
- Sometimes [revolution](revolution.md) (and even [war](war.md), temporary dictatorship etc.) is seen by some "communists" as a necessary way of achieving a change, however many others oppose this as revolution means violence, dominating man by another man (inequality) etc. -- peaceful voluntary evolutionary approach is also an option of achieving communism.
- Focus on workers and common people.
- Intellectual endeavor and idealism -- many communists are intellectuals, scientifically examining society and seeking models of an ideal society, a "[utopia](utopia.md)" as opposed to accepting life in a [dystopia](dystopia.md).
